Finger-Food Potato Mochi with Tofu

For Stage 3 babies (10 months or older) who are eating by hands. Using potato and tofu as a base, this mochi has a mild flavor with the subtle sweetness of Koji Amazake. Good as a snack or even as a meal!

Cooking time

10 minutes

Calories

13 kcal

Salt

0.1 g

*Calories and salt are per piece.

Ingredients

Ingredients : about 15 pieces (3.5 cm)

  • Potato 1 medium potato (100-130 g)
  • Firm tofu 50 g

Seasonings

  • Koji Amazake 2 tbsp
  • Salt pinch
  • Salad oil small amount
  • Potato starch 1 tbsp

Instructions

  • 1Wash the potato and use a knife to cut an X into the skin. Wrap in a damp paper towel and then a piece of plastic wrap.
  • 2Heat potato in microwave for 2 minutes (600W), then turn over and heat for another 1 minute and 30 seconds. Peel potato.
  • 3Break tofu into chunks by hand and drain any liquid.
  • 4Put potato in a mixing bowl and mash with a masher or fork. Add Koji Amazake and continue to mash.
  • 5Add crumbled tofu to potato mixture, then add salt and potato starch. Mix well.
    Shape mixture into balls about 3.5 cm in diameter (approx. 10 g) and flatten.
  • 6Heat oil in a frying pan. Cook flattened balls on both sides until browned. *If using dried green seaweed, add 1/4 tsp of seaweed to half of the potato mixture in step 5) and knead it together.
Tips

・Poke the potato with a skewer through the wrap and,if it is still hard,
continue to heat it for increments of 30 seconds.

・Potato mochi dough may be frozen in plastic wrap.

・Cooking time does not include chilling time.

[Comment from Dr. Yasuyo, an expert in Japan on baby food]
This recipe contains tofu and is full of protein!
It stays chewy even as it cools, so it’s perfect as a snack on the go.
